rabbit-dev

現役スマフォプログラマーが適当にプログラム関係の記事を放り込むブログ

ScrollViewのスクロールを止めてみた。

ということで表題の通りScrollViewのスクロールを止めてみた。

メニュー表示中にスクロールさせたくない時とかに使えるはず。

 

コード

// スクロールを無効にする。

scrollView->setTouchEnabled(false);

// スクロールを有効にする。

 scrollView->setTouchEnabled(true);

 

その他

内部では、TouchEventの削除/再登録を行っている。

ScrollViewはTouchBeginなどをつかって処理しているためこれでスクロールを止めることが可能。